First Half Frenzy

The first half of the Brunei vs Indonesia match was nothing short of a rollercoaster! Right from the kickoff, both teams came out with guns blazing, showcasing their tactical prowess and determination. The Indonesian side, known for their swift attacking plays, immediately put pressure on Brunei's defense. Within the first 15 minutes, Indonesia's star striker, Ronaldo Kwateh, made a dazzling run, leaving defenders in the dust, and fired a powerful shot that ricocheted off the crossbar. The crowd went wild, sensing that a goal was imminent. Brunei, however, didn't back down. Their defensive line, led by captain Haji Tarif, stood strong, thwarting several Indonesian attacks with well-timed tackles and interceptions. Brunei's midfield also played a crucial role in disrupting Indonesia's flow, with Hakeme Yazid Said making some impressive passes and creating opportunities for counter-attacks. One notable moment was when he skillfully maneuvered through three Indonesian players and sent a through ball to Adi Said, who unfortunately couldn't convert it into a goal due to the quick response of the Indonesian goalkeeper, Ernando Ari. As the clock ticked down, tensions rose, and the match became more physical. Several yellow cards were handed out for reckless challenges, reflecting the high stakes and competitive spirit of both teams. Despite numerous attempts and close calls, the first half ended in a 0-0 stalemate, leaving fans eagerly anticipating what the second half would bring. The tactical adjustments made by both coaches during the break would undoubtedly play a crucial role in determining the outcome of this highly anticipated match.

Second Half Showdown

The second half of the Brunei vs Indonesia match witnessed an escalation of intensity and strategic maneuvers. Indonesia, clearly determined to break the deadlock, implemented a more aggressive attacking strategy. Their efforts paid off in the 55th minute when Egy Maulana Vikri capitalized on a defensive error by Brunei, slotting the ball past the goalkeeper with finesse. The stadium erupted in cheers as Indonesia took a 1-0 lead. However, Brunei refused to concede defeat. They reorganized their defense and launched several counter-attacks, testing Indonesia's resilience. In the 68th minute, Brunei's Razimie Ramlli delivered a stunning cross into the penalty box, finding Azwan Ali Rahman, who headed the ball towards the goal. But Ernando Ari, the Indonesian goalkeeper, made a spectacular save, denying Brunei an equalizer. As the match entered its final stages, Indonesia solidified their lead with a second goal in the 78th minute. Ramadhan Sananta showcased his incredible speed and precision, outrunning the Bruneian defense and scoring with a well-placed shot. With a 2-0 advantage, Indonesia appeared to be in control, but Brunei continued to fight valiantly. Despite their efforts, they couldn't penetrate Indonesia's solid defense. The match concluded with Indonesia securing a 2-0 victory, marking a significant triumph in their campaign. The second half highlighted not only the individual brilliance of players like Egy Maulana Vikri and Ramadhan Sananta but also the tactical adjustments and unwavering determination of both teams.
